One very hard thing to understand is why things happen the way they do. Why is it that good people have bad things happen? Well that is just life. http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=ig4jbcU9db0 . So in order to “cope with life” we must keep things in their respective places with perspective. Let’s not make anything a bigger deal than what it is and if we have a problem with someone or something let’s strive to get past it. Holding on to those negative feelings or ideas will never ever do anything for you.
Today as we go through our life and coping, if our perspective is out of whack, then let’s shift our focus inward and see what is REALLY going on! Normally when my perspective is off kilter, it is nothing the other person or thing has done at this point. It is nine times out of ten my lack of understanding that is what causes it. The initial bad thing happened. OK it’s done and let it lie there. No need to continue dragging the event out past the initial. So then that needs to be filed away, but keep in mind if a certain person is always causing you grief it might behoove you to reexamine this relationship with them in regards to your own personal and mental health.
Next, when you feel life is shaking you from your very core, remember your values and believes. If you have a solid foundation then stand up and stand firm! Stand strong. Nothing can harm you at this point in the game. Finally, restore faith in yourself and like Lucille Ball said, “…it doesn’t pay to get discouraged”. Stay positive and you will go far…
Step 1: Keep everything in perspective.
Step 2: When something goes wrong, find a solution, don’t dwell on it and move on as quick as possible…
Step 3: Stand firm in your values and believes.
Step 4: Have faith in yourself and don’t get discouraged.
